What Exactly is a Color Scheme Randomizer?

A color scheme randomizer, often referred to as a palette randomizer or colour palette randomiser, is a digital tool designed to generate a set of colors that work well together. At its core, it takes an input (or no input at all, defaulting to pure randomness) and outputs a selection of hues, saturation levels, and brightness values that form a cohesive color palette. These tools can be as simple as a button that spins and produces a new set of colors, or as sophisticated as generators that allow for user-defined parameters, such as specifying a primary color, a mood, or a style.

Think of it as a digital muse. Instead of sifting through countless swatches or relying on pre-defined, often overused, palettes, you can let the randomizer do the heavy lifting. It can produce palettes based on various color theory principles, such as complementary, analogous, triadic, or tetradic color schemes, or it might simply combine colors in a statistically pleasing, yet unexpected, way. The beauty lies in its ability to surprise you with combinations that are both novel and aesthetically pleasing.

The underlying technology often involves algorithms that select colors from a vast spectrum, sometimes incorporating rules of color harmony or even machine learning models trained on successful designs. The goal is always to provide a starting point, a visual foundation, upon which you can build your creative vision. Understand Color Theory Basics

While the randomizer does the heavy lifting, a basic understanding of color theory will help you evaluate the output. Familiarize yourself with concepts like:

  • Hue: The pure color (e.g., red, blue, green).
  • Saturation: The intensity or purity of the color.
  • Brightness/Value: The lightness or darkness of a color.
  • Color Harmonies: Complementary (opposite on the color wheel), Analogous (next to each other), Triadic (equally spaced), Tetradic (two complementary pairs).

Knowing these concepts will help you judge if a random palette offers good contrast, is visually balanced, or evokes the desired feeling.

Types of Color Randomizers and How They Work

While the core function is the same, color scheme randomizers can differ in their approach and sophistication:

Basic Random Color Generators

These are the simplest. They typically generate a set of 3-5 colors with no user input. The algorithms might simply pick colors from the entire spectrum, or they might have a slight bias towards more commonly perceived "pleasant" combinations. The primary keyword, "color scheme randomizer," often brings up these straightforward tools.

Rule-Based Palettizers

These tools incorporate basic color theory principles. You might be able to select a color harmony type (e.g., complementary, analogous, triadic) and then let the generator find colors that fit that rule. The "color randomizer generator" may offer these options, allowing for more controlled yet still inspired results.

Seeded Color Randomizers

These allow you to input one or more "seed" colors. The generator then creates a palette that harmonizes with your chosen colors. This is incredibly useful when you have a specific color you need to work with, such as a brand color or an image element.

Algorithmic and AI-Powered Generators

These are more advanced. They might use complex algorithms to analyze aesthetic principles, or even employ machine learning models trained on vast datasets of successful color combinations from art, design, and photography. They can often generate highly nuanced and sophisticated palettes.

Image-Based Color Extractors

While not strictly randomizers, these tools are closely related and often found alongside them. You upload an image, and the tool extracts a color palette from it. This is a fantastic way to draw inspiration from existing visuals, like nature, fashion, or artwork, and then use a randomizer to subtly alter or expand upon that extracted palette.

Contextual Randomizers

Some tools aim to generate palettes based on a mood, emotion, or even keywords. For example, you might select "calm" or "energetic," and the generator will produce palettes associated with those feelings. This is where a "colour scheme randomiser" might offer a more intuitive user experience.

Can a color randomizer ensure my palette is accessible?

Most basic randomizers don't inherently guarantee accessibility. However, many advanced tools and standalone accessibility checkers can analyze your generated palette. Look for tools that provide contrast ratio information or allow you to test color combinations against WCAG (Web Content Accessibility Guidelines) standards.
